Located in the Providence School District at 152 Springfield St in Providence, RI, Governor Christopher Delsesto Middle School serves grades 6-8 and has an enrollment of roughly 922 students. Frequently Asked Questions about Providence
How much are Studio apartments in Providence?
There are currently 877 Studio Apartments in Providence with rent ranges from $742 to $3,462 with an average price of $1,917.
What is the current price range for One Bedroom Providence Apartments for rent?
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Providence ranges from $876 to $4,445 with an average monthly rent of $2,140.
What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Providence cost?
The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Providence range from $1,205 to $6,133.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$2,596.
How expensive are Providence Three Bedroom Apartments?
There are currently 425 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in Providence on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$1,600 to $6,977 - averaging $2,685 for the location.
